§ 42:1A-42 — Partner's act after dissolution

42.Subject to section 43 of this act, a partnership is bound by a partner's act after dissolution that: a. Is appropriate for winding up the partnership business; or b. Would have bound the partnership under section 13 of this act before dissolution, if the other party to the transaction did not have notice of the dissolution. L.2000,c.161,s.42.
